2021 SESSION
WHEREAS, Millbrook High School students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side raised more than $1,000 to support Henry and William Evans Home for Children by hosting the Winter Waddle Week, a virtual one-mile walk; and
WHEREAS,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side organized the Winter Waddle as an activity for Millbrook High School’s chapter of DECA, a national organization that fosters leadership development among marketing students; and
WHEREAS, working with their DECA advisor, Jenny Stover,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side contacted the Henry and William Evans Home for Children, which provides sanctuary to abused and homeless children, and set a fundraising goal of $300; and
WHEREAS, when the outbreak of the COVID-19 pandemic made it impossible to hold the event as planned,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side reorganized the Winter Waddle as a one-week virtual walk, allowing participants to support the event from their homes or neighborhoods; and
WHEREAS,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side designed and sold Winter Waddle t-shirts, with all proceeds benefiting the Henry and William Evans Home for Children; the students ultimately almost quadrupled their goal by raising $1,100 between December 19 and December 27, 2020; and
WHEREAS,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side set an excellent example of community leadership for their fellow young people in Winchester, and their contributions to the Henry and William Evans Home for Children have helped the organization continue to carry out its vital mission; now, therefore, be it
RESOLVED by the House of Delegates, That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side hereby be commended for hosting the Winter Waddle Week to raise money for the Henry and William Evans Home for Children in Winchester; and, be it
RESOLVED FURTHER, That the Clerk of the House of Delegates prepare copies of this resolution for presentation to Marisol Aquila and Ashley Pacheco-Arroside as an expression of the House of Delegates’ admiration for their work to support young people in need.
